WebHow to Change Your Deed to Reflect Your New Name. This question is more complex than it seems at first. In its simplest form, you are not required to take any action. When you sell the property at some point in the future, simply indicate on the deed, for example: “Mary Smith, NKA (now known as) Mary Jones hereby grants…etc.”. Failure to put your name in the "Transferred To" section ... WebJul 29, 2024 · New York state property owners cannot add or change a name on a title. The law requires the property owner to file a new deed reflecting the change. However, if the original deed has errors, they can file a correction deed, which does not convey title. It merely perfects the original deed.

WebDec 9, 2024 · If you opt to retain the name you used as a single person on a real estate deed, you can still sell or transfer the property. Simply write your previous name followed by the name you are currently using. For example, you could sign "Jane Doe, currently known as Jane Smith."
